Image Part Number Manufacturer Description Availability
Online Service
1751170 Phoenix Contact
Fixed Terminal Blocks SMKDS 1/10-3.5
96
In stock
Get Quote
1728365 Phoenix Contact
Fixed Terminal Blocks SMKDS 1/10-3 81
185
In stock
Get Quote